Bathroom Rankings

Over on 11points, the current posting is regarding the ranking of public bathroom options.  While I disagree with parts of his ranking, I decided to go to the expert on all things toilet-related, Uncle Mickey (infamous for the Uncle Mickey Special)...  His thoughts:

Oh this topic hits home, but I disagree with the list in its entirety.  Well, not the whole list, but the order of it, his order
  • Hotels
  • Museums
  • Sit down restaurant
  • Emergency room
  • Target/Walmat/Costco/Grocery store
  • Library
  • Fast food restaurants
  • Indoor gas station
  • Bar
  • Outdoor gas station
  • Public park
My order and explanations:
  • Hotels / Casinos- Agreed that the hotel bathroom stop is usually the best out there, esp the higher end ones. They are convenient, free, clean, and usually very empty. I would probably add casinos to this list as well, as they are usually top notch in terms of cleanliness and comforts. The only downside to the casino bathroom is they are always packed, but a lot of high end casinos go with the full length door which is like being in heaven.
  • Department store- Big box stores, higher end the better, Nordstrom is top notch, Macys is usually good, Sears and Boscovs, your treading on thin ice. Usually pretty clean, lot of stalls, little company.
  • Barnes and Noble/Home Depot/Lowes- This is essentially taking the place of the library bathroom, although I guess I could lump the library into it, tho I haven’t been nor plan to be in a library for some time. These places are perfect stops, always pretty clean, usually quite empty as people are not doing this business in these establishments. And to top it off, Home Depot and Lowes usually have very nice bathrooms cause they are home improvement stores, so they use their own tiles and features to show them off.
  • Sit down restaurants- This one depends widely on type and location. Typically they will be pretty clean but space is usually an issue. Lot of these places have 1 maybe 2 stalls, which no matter what type of cleaning efforts, you cant keep up with. Nothing worse then feeling the heat when you walk into the stall from the last person. Again, you talk about any restaurant in a big city, like NY and forget it, your lucky if they have a bathroom.
  • Museums- This is hit or miss. This guys experience at the Met, yea sure it was great and big and nice. But most museums don’t have the super large space and these days give an S about cleaning as much as they used to. Think about it, your not paying to go anyway, so do you think they have the money to throw around on a stellar janitor. No.
  • Emergency room- This is ridiculous, hospitals are huge and you have to park and figure out where your going. I don’t see this as even on my list, and for the main part this is why. They don’t have large multi-person bathrooms, but singles. Now I know what your saying, how could you not like the single, its as private as it gets. Well, I don’t like the fact that if someone is looking to go, then I have to deal with the dreaded knock. The clean, big multi-person ones you can tuck yourself in a corner and even if someone comes in, you wont be bothered. Hospitals don’t have those.
  • Indoor gas station (Wawa only)- Wawa bathrooms are pretty decent in the day and age of the super Wawa’s. Privacy isn’t great, usually 1 stall but in this rarified space of where the quality on this list is heading, its tops of the donkeys, but no race horse.
  • Rest stop- Very busy, people are there for that reason and that reason alone usually, cleanliness isn’t great but usually doable and they are big.
  • Bar- Now this category is a tough one, cause its really 2 categories, daytime bar and nighttime bar.
    • Day bar – usually fine, id equate it to a sit down restaurant.
    • Night bar – not happened, ever, I will end my night and go home. The lines are bad enough to piss, and no one cares where it goes.
  • Outdoor gas stations and public parks- Same category here, I really see no differentiation. This again is where I change my plans for the day or whatever im doing in order to avoid this. No joke, I usually piss behind gas stations before I go into the outdoor bathroom to do it. Do you think I'm gonna head in for the ole deuce, no, not a chance. Its just as easy to find a Target, or Macys or Applebee's then submit to this. And if they arnt available, outside is.
